#F575BE Color
#F575BE is rgb(245, 117, 190) in RGB, hsl(326, 86%, 71%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 52%, 22%, 4%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Persian Pink (#F77FBE),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.45.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#F575BE Channel Values
How #F575BE bre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 245 · G 117 · B 190 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 326° · S 86% · L 71%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 326° · S 52% · V 96%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 52% · Y 22% · K 4%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.57:1 vs white · 8.17: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#F575BE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#F575BE?
#F575BE is a light pink — rgb(245, 117, 190) in RGB and hsl(326, 86%, 71%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Persian Pink (#F77FBE),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.45.
What is the RGB value of #F575BE?
#F575BE is rgb(245, 117, 190) — red 245, green 117, and blue 190 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#F575BE?
#F575BE conver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 52%, 22%, 4%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#F575BE be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#F575BE scores 2.57:1 against white and 8.17: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#F575BE as a CSS color keyword?
No. #F575BE is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is hotpink (#FF69B4) at a CIE76 distance of 8.73,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
